What is called road accident?

What is called road accident?

A traffic accident is defined as an accident involving at least one vehicle on a road open to public traffic in which at least one person is injured or killed.

WHO report on road accidents in India?

With only 1 per cent of the world’s vehicles, India accounts for 11 per cent of the global death in road accidents, the highest in the world, according to a report by the World Bank. The country accounts for about 4.5 lakh road crashes per annum, in which 1.5 lakh people die.

Which country has less accidents?

European nations like Norway, Sweden and Switzerland all have less than 4 accidents per 1,00,000 people (in India it is 16.6) because of proper implementation of regulations that reduce deaths due to traffic accidents.

Which state has most accidents in India?

The statistics show that Uttar Pradesh is ranked the highest when it comes to deaths caused due to road accidents. In 2018, more than 42,568 road accidents were reported in the most populated state of the country.

What is the major cause of the accident in India?

Crossing the speed limit: Overspeeding is one of the major causes of road accidents in India. Many riders cross the speed limit in areas where it is dangerous to do so.

What is the accident rate in India?

Adjusted for 182.45 million vehicles and its 1.31 billion population, India reported a traffic collision rate of about 0.8 per 1000 vehicles in 2015 compared to 0.9 per 1000 vehicles in 2012, and an 11.35 fatality rate per 100,000 people in 2015.

How many accidents happen a day in India?

In India, two-thirds of road traffic injury (RTI) deaths are reported in the age group 15–44 years. [1] In 2017, officially reported road accidents were 464,910, claiming 147,913 deaths and 470,975 injured persons, that is, 405 deaths and 1,290 injuries each day from 1,274 accidents.
